This major initiative from Bewdley Festival has the aim of significantly increasing the support of the arts in Bewdley and communities across Wyre Forest.
The Bewdley Community Arts Foundation (BCAF) is a grant making body that represents the next stage of Bewdley Festival’s vision for securing resources for the arts in our community for future generations.
